Abstract
Abstract: This study describes an investigation on Suzuki and Heck cross-couplings of aryl electrophiles in the presence of heterogeneous Pd nanoparticles supported on amino-vinyl silica functionalized magnetic carbon nanotube. The core–shell contains CNT@Fe3O4@SiO2-Pd in which the functionalized SiO2 helps the stabilization of Pd nanoparticles and also responsible for the reduction of Pd(II) to Pd(0) without the need for adding external reducing agents. All of the reactions were done under phosphine-free condition. Graphical Abstract: [Figure not available: see fulltext.]
